Taiwanese electronics manufacturer Asus may join the likes of Nokia, Reliance Jio, and Micromax, who are said to be working on Android Oreo (Go edition) smartphones. An alleged Asus smartphone with model number X00RD has appeared in a benchmarking website, with just 1GB of RAM and Android 8.1 Oreo.
Asus has already released invitations for its event at MWC 2018 in Barcelona, where the ZenFone 5 2018 series, including the ZenFone 5 Lite, is expected to be launched. Meanwhile, we can also expect the leaked smartphone to get announced at the event.
As per the specifications revealed in Geekbench, the upcoming smartphone runs Android version 8.1.0. The handset will be powered by a Snapdragon 425 SoC, which is a quad-core processor clocked at 1.4GHz. The Snapdragon 425 is a 28nm processor and comes with support for up to 800×1280 pixels resolution.
The specification list of the Asus X00RD does not reveal too many details. However, the handset scored 640 in single-core test and 1,664 in multi-core test.
It should be noted that the is no explicit mention on whether the Asus Zenfone X00RD will come with Android Oreo (Go edition) or not. However, given the specifications, it will be surprising if the company brings out a handset with 1GB RAM, without Android Go. However, Asus has not shared any plans officially, regarding the launch of an Android (Go edition) smartphone.
Android Oreo (Go edition) aka Android Go is a trimmed down version of Android Oreo aimed at low-cost smartphones. Google had announced Android Go during the opening keynote of the I/O developers conference in 2017. Android Go is a program similar to Android One that also aims to improve the budget smartphones ecosystem.

Airtel and Google have partnered to launch low-cost 4G smartphones powered by Android Oreo (Go Edition) in India. Lava and Micromax will manufacture the first set of devices. These smartphones will also come pre-loaded with several apps, including MyAirtel App, Airtel TV and Wynk Music. Starting March 2018, all entry-level 4G smartphones unveiled under Airtel’s ‘Mera Pehla Smartphone’ program will be shipped with Android Oreo (Go Edition).
Android Oreo (Go edition) is a tailored version of the Android Oreo, customised to offer a smooth experience on devices with 512MB to 1GB RAM. The devices running Android Ore (Go Edition) come with a set of customised apps that have been designed to run faster while using less data. These include Google Go, Google Assistant Go, YouTube Go, Google Maps Go, Gmail Go, Gboard, Google Play, Chrome, and Files Go.

Xiaomi Mi Max 3 is said to be one of the Chinese mobile maker’s next smartphone launches, with several leaks finding their way to the internet since December last year. Details regarding the anticipated Xiaomi Mi MIX 2S and Mi 7 handsets have also leaked in several reports. Now, more information regarding specifications and features of the Mi Max 3 has also surfaced online. New rumours suggest that the smartphone from Xiaomi will come with a plethora of interesting features including wireless charging, iris scanner and more.
XDA Developers claims specifications of the Xiaomi Mi Max 3 based on firmware files obtained by Funky Huawei of FunkyHuawei.club. According to the files, the handset will be powered by a Qualcomm Snapdragon 660 SoC. However, there is a chance that there might be Snapdragon 630 SoC variant as well. The battery capacity of the Mi Max 3 is said to be 5500mAh – larger than the 5300mAh battery on the Mi Max 2. The report also confirms that the smartphone will sport a display with 18:9 aspect ratio. This is in line with an earlier report that had hinted at a 6.99-inch display on the ‘phablet’ along with the same battery specification.
Meanwhile, the highlight of the latest rumour is the inclusion of wireless charging in the Xiaomi Mi Max 3. Xiaomi had become a member of the Wireless Power Consortium that is known for its Qi wireless charging standard last year. This means that the Mi Max 3 could be the first handset from the company that features Qi wireless charging. XDA Developers found “two pieces of direct evidence” in the firmware that support this claim. The report also said that even the upcoming Mi 7 could introduce the same technology.
Further, the report highlights that the rear camera on Mi Max 3 could have either a Sony IMX363 sensor or a Samsung S5K217+S5K5E8 dual camera setup. For the selfie camera, there will be a S5K4H7 sensor from Samsung, the report adds. Interestingly, the Xiaomi Mi Mix 3 may also come with an Omnivision 2281 iris scanner.
The firmware file also reveals that the smartphone will run on the latest Android 8.1 Oreo. Other features revealed in the leak include dual-SIM slot, dual SD card support, IR Blaster, LED light notifications, audio tuned by Dirac, and Qualcomm’s aptX and aptX HD Bluetooth audio codecs. It may also come with dual speakers and a front sensor called “remosic”.
To recall, previous reports had suggested that the Mi Max 3 is expected to launch in June 2018 at a price of CNY 1,699 (roughly Rs. 17,400).

New Delhi: Bharti Airtel on Monday launched its Online Store that will offer a line-up of premium smartphones with affordable down payments, instant credit verification financing and bundled monthly plans.
iPhone lovers can buy iPhone 7 (32 GB variant) at a down payment of Rs 7,777, with 24 monthly installments of Rs 2,499.
The monthly installments have a built-in postpaid plan which offers 30GB data, unlimited calling (local, STD, national roaming) and Airtel “Secure” package.
“This is another exciting digital innovation from Airtel to delight customers. We are making the entire process seamless and simple through digital technology,” said Harmeen Mehta, Global CEO and Director-Engineering, Bharti Airtel, in a statement.
The Online Store services are currently available in 21 cities and will be expanded to others in the near future.

State-owned Bharat Sanchar Nigam Ltd today introduced unlimited prepaid mobile plans starting at Rs 99 for the Calcutta telecom circle to take on rising competition. The telecom operator was also bullish on the 2,100 MHz spectrum band before its 4G roll-out here, which could be as early as from March this year, Calcutta Telephones CGM S P Tripathi said.
“We expect spectrum in the 2,100 MHz band within days and equipment is also ready,” he said, sounding optimistic about the 4G roll-out in phases across the city with 650-odd towers. He said the new plan starts from Rs 99 for 26 days and Rs 319 for 90 days unlimited voice calls with roaming, except in Delhi and Mumbai.
At Rs 999, the company will offer unlimited calls and 1GB/day high-speed data for 181 days. Tripathi said he expects the next fiscal year 2018-19 to be ‘much better’ for the company as the price war gradually settles. In the current fiscal, Calcutta Telephones is hopeful of clocking revenues between Rs 510 crores and Rs 550 crore, while losses are pegged at about Rs 350 crores, company officials said.
It is also focusing on recovery of dues from institutional and retail customers to the tune of Rs.300 crores.

Airtel and Jio are constantly keeping the telecom industry on its toes, with high-speed data becoming ever cheaper. To compete with them on an even footing, Vodafone has introduced two new prepaid packs that offer unlimited voice calls and high speed data access for a validity of 28 days. Part of Vodafone’s SuperPlans, the new Rs. 158 pack offers unlimited voice calls (250 minutes/ day and 1,000 minutes/ week), and 1GB 4G/ 3G data per day, with a validity of 28 days. The second pack is priced at Rs. 151 and offers unlimited voice calls and a total of 1GB 4G/ 3G data with a validity of 28 days. Both packs are currently applicable only in the Kerala circle.
The Rs. 158 pack has been launched in direct competition to Reliance Jio’s Rs. 149 pack that offers unlimited voice calls, 100 SMS messages per day, and 1.5GB data per day with a validity of 28 days. It also takes on Airtel’s Rs. 169 pack that offers unlimited calls, 100 SMS messages per day, and 1GB data per day with a validity of 28 days for Airtel partnered 4G handsets and a validity of 14 days for other handsets.
While the tariff pack hasn’t yet been launched in other major telecom circles including Delhi NCR and Mumbai, Vodafone’s Rs. 198 prepaid pack – applicable in these and most other telecom circles – offers unlimited voice calls, 100 SMSes per day, and 1.4GB 3G/ 4G data per day, with a validity of 28 days.
On the other hand, the Rs. 151 pack takes on Airtel’s Rs. 93 prepaid pack that was recently upgraded to offer unlimited voice calls, 100 SMS messages per day, and a total of 1GB data, with a validity of 28 days. There is a Rs. 109 pack from Idea Cellular that has similar benefits with a validity of 14 days.
Interestingly enough, the Rs. 158 prepaid pack is just Rs. 7 more expensive than the Rs. 151 pack, although it offers total benefits of 28GB data compared to just 1GB on the later.

With all the emerging UPI payments in the smartphone business, Google has also launched its UPI wallet Google Tez exclusively for India last year. The company has now partnered with 80 billers in India of various services and allows its users to pay their utility bills.
When the app first launched in India, it allowed users to transfer money between friends and in-between the contacts via UPI. It also allowed users to pay to the retailers who had UPI based payment gateways. Now, Google is adding utility bill payments feature for its users, the company said in a blog post, “Adding a new biller is a breeze, and you only have to do it once. Just tap on New Payment and then Pay your bills. You’ll see a list of billers supported on Tez across locations. You can also search for them by name. Once you’ve located your biller, enter the number associated with your account to link it to Tez and give it an easy name to remember.”
Tez will also fetch your utility bills every month and reminds the user by sending a timely notification. The user who has already linked his bank account to his mobile through Tez can directly pay his bills on time with this new feature. “Checking whether you’ve paid a bill in the app is as simple as tapping the biller’s name on your Tez home screen. There, you’ll be able to view all past payments grouped by biller, as well as manage bills from multiple accounts,” the company said in its blog post.
Tez has a support of including national and state electricity providers, gas and water, and DTH recharge. These include billers like Reliance Energy, BSES and DishTV, and in total will cover all states and major metros in India. Tez also supports Bharat BillPay system, which lets you fetch the latest bill from your providers.
Google to encourage its users to use Tez, is offering a scratch card for Rs 1000 for every new utility biller being added by the user this month.

Vodafone RED postpaid plans have been revised to offer up to 10GB more data. The company’s RED Basic and RED Traveler-R plans give users 10GB extra data, while the company’s RED Traveler-M plan now offers 5GB more data. Vodafone is also giving Rs 100 waiver for six months with the RED Traveler-R pack. This is a limited period offer.
To give a perspective, Vodafone RED-Basic plan of Rs 399 previously offered 10GB data, which has been revised to give users a total of 20GB. Vodafone RED Traveler-R plan of Rs 499 data offering has been increased from 20GB to 30GB. The company will now give a total of 40GB data with RED Traveler-M plan of Rs 699, instead of 35GB previously.
All Vodafone RED plan users get unlimited local, STD and national roaming along with free incoming and outgoing national roaming, 100 free local and national SMS as well as carry forward data facility. Up to 200GB data can be accumulated to carry forward.
All Vodafone RED plan users except those on RED Basic plan get free subscription to MAGZTER for up to 12 months. People can choose from over 4000 magazines. Vodafone’s RED Shield Device Security offer that protects user’s smartphones from theft and damage, can also be availed by these users.
Rival Airtel has revamped its Infinity postpaid plans as well to offer double data along with free unlimited calls. Airtel has revised the data offerings on its popular postpaid plans, starting from Rs 399 going up all the way to Rs 1199. All postpaid Infinity plans from Airtel include unlimited local, STD and incoming roaming calls as well as outgoing roaming calls.

Competing against Jio and Airtel, Idea Cellular has launched a prepaid pack offering ‘unlimited calls’ at Rs. 109. The new pack comes with a validity of 14 days and is initially limited to select circles. The telco has brought the new pack days after launching the Rs. 93 pack that offers unlimited voice calling benefits alongside 1GB of data for 10 days. That pack countered the Rs. 93 pack by Airtel that, back then, offered a similar tariff and validity. However, Airtel now offers 28-day validity, free calls and 1GB data at the same price now, which is twice the validity the new Idea pack offers. Similarly, the Jio Rs. 98 recharge offers a validity of 28 days, unlimited voice calls as well as 2GB of 4G data.
According to the official Idea Cellular website, the Rs. 109 prepaid pack offers ‘unlimited’ local, STD, and roaming calls, alongside 1GB of 4G/ 3G data and daily 100 local and national SMS. The voice calls through the pack are limited to 250 minutes per day and 1,000 minutes per week, identical to other ‘unlimited’ packs. Furthermore, beyond the bundled calls, subscribers will be charged at 1 paisa per second for calls.
The pack is available in a few circles, including Andhra Pradesh and Telangana, Bihar and Jharkhand, Gujarat, Haryana, and Karnataka, among others. The availability of 4G/ 3G data is subject to the network rollout. Subscribers can recharge their accounts with the new Rs. 109 pack either through the operator’s official site or via My Idea app.
Earlier this week, Idea revised its Nirvana Postpaid plans to offer additional data benefits at existing charges. The plans that have been revised include the Rs. 499, Rs. 649, Rs. 999, Rs. 389, Rs. 1,299, Rs. 1,699, Rs. 1,999, and Rs. 2,999. While the lowest among all the plans, the Rs. 398 plan, offers 20GB of data – up from 10GB, the Rs. 2,999 plan comes with 300GB of data for a month.

Facebook-owned WhatsApp is one of the largest messaging platforms in the world. In 2017, the popular messaging service unveiled several features in order to enhance user experience and now it seems that the company might bring some more useful features to the table to spice up users experience in 2018. Some of the new features were spotted in beta versions for iOS and Android.
If rumours are to be believed, WhatsApp users might soon be able to edit sent messages and make group calls for voice and video on WhatsApp. The company lately introduced ‘Delete for Everyone’ feature that lets users delete a sent message within seven minutes of sending it. However, the highly anticipated feature — edit sent messages might be the extension of it. Here’s a look at some of the major features that WhatsApp might unveil in 2018.
WhatsApp UPI-based payments integration for India: WhatsApp might soon roll out the UPI-based payments feature in India. The company has already started testing the Unified Payments Interface (UPI) functionality and is said to be in talks with State Bank of India (SBI), National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) and other institutions to integrate peer-to-peer payment system in the app.
According to GizmoTimes, the new UPI integration feature is available for select WhatsApp beta users on iOS (2.18.21) and Android (2.18.41), enabling users to send and receive money using the Indian government’s UPI standard. This new feature is said to be available alongside other options such as Video, Gallery, Documents and others.
Additionally, the payments platform’s integration may give boost digital payments in India, considering the number of active users on the platform in the country. Moreover, with the new feature, users could instantly transfer their funds between two people or a bank account directly through WhatsApp. Furthermore, both the sender and receiver need to have the WhatsApp Payments feature to successfully transact on the app, as per FoneArena.
WhatsApp ability to edit sent messages: The ability to edit sent messages is one of the highly anticipated and long-awaited features on popular messaging service WhatsApp. “WhatsApp had added in beta the possibility to edit messages that you already sent, and it is actually disabled by default and it’s under development,” reads a tweet by WABetaInfo. As of now, it is not known whether this feature will make its way or not. Currently, WhatsApp rolled out a feature that enables users to delete a sent message and the recipient gets a notification saying the message has been deleted.
WhatsApp group calls: WhatsApp might soon roll out group calling feature that will let users add up to three members in a group video call. However, switching between group video call to voice call isn’t available yet. A total of four people would be a part of this group call, including the person who started the call. The feature is available in Android beta version 2.18.39.
WABetaInfo said that “the group calling feature will available for everyone in the future, though an exact timeline is not known.” Previously, WhatsApp group voice calls feature was available on the version 2.17.70 of WhatsApp Android beta in October 2017 and the messaging service app will apparently release group voice call feature this year.
Besides, WhatsApp recently launched the “WhatsApp for Business” app, targeted for businesses and helps them connect with their customers. The app is currently available for small businesses enables the business’ to connect with the customers using features such as Business Profiles, Messaging Statistics, Account Type, and Messaging Tools.

Bharti Airtel has revised its Rs. 93 prepaid plan in order to compete with the Rs. 98 plan that is offered by Reliance Jio. At Rs. 93, the company is offering benefits such as 1GB of data, unlimited calls be it local, STD and roaming and 100 SMS per day for 28 days. This plan is valid only in select circles and we can expect it to be rolled out to all Airtel users soon.
The Airtel website has listed the Rs. 93 plan but it is not found in the My Airtel app for reasons unknown. Notably, the Rs. 93 plan listed on the website is applicable for all users. It bundles same benefits as mentioned above but the validity is 10 days for most users and 28 days for select users.
Lately, Airtel has been revising a lot of its tariff plans offering higher data benefits at the same cost. The company recently revised its prepaid plans so that it can offer 1.4GB of data instead of 1GB. Also, it revised the Infinity postpaid plans for the users offering double the data benefits per billing cycle. The Rs. 93 plan has been revised in order to compete with the Rs. 98 plan of Reliance Jio. Notably, the Rs. 98 plan offers 2GB of data and unlimited voice calls for the same validity of 28 days.
When it comes to benefits, the Jio plan is better as it offers 300 SMS per day instead of 100 SMS per day and 1GB of additional data. Also, the Jio users get the access to the Jio suite of apps that is an added advantage.
